Purestar Group is Hiring a Van Drivers Near Hilo, HI

We are looking for Team Members who will be part of our growing Ohana!

Here are some of the benefits our employees enjoy for their contributions to our success:
  • Medical, Drug & Vision and Dental coverage for employees.
  • Group Life Insurance
  • Health and Dependent Care Flexible Spending Accounts
  • Paid Time Off
  • 401(K) with Company Match
  • Tuition Reimbursement Program
  • Career advancement within the company
  • Various incentive programs
Responsible for driving to and from designated locations, transporting soiled linen and delivering clean linen products to hotel customers, while verifying loads and adhering to state and Federal Regulations.

Workers typically perform a variety of tasks, which may include any combination of the following:
  • Conduct Pre & Post Trip Inspection of truck
  • Assists dispatchers and weighmasters by positioning carts in appropriate area and covering cart with plastic
  • Loads clean linen into trucks, checking to ensure accuracy of load against delivery ticket
  • Drives truck to specified customer locations and unloads clean linen carts, interacting with hotel staff
  • Communicates customer concerns or complaints promptly to Production or Logistics Manager on duty
  • Completes trip sheet to reflect all stops, number of carts delivered, and number of carts retrieved
  • Report all mechanical issues, accidents and/or incidents involving drivers or company equipment
  • Promptly report any delays to supervisor/manager relating to pick-up or delivery of load, (breakdowns, weather of traffic
  • Perform all duties in accordance with company policies and procedures, and comply with all federal, state and local regulations for the safe operations of a commercial motor vehicle.
  • Professional representation of the Company and the trucking industry through responsible driving and appearance
  • Drivers must comply with all Customers’ safety and delivery requirements
  • Ability to pass a drug test
Qualifications and Minimum Requirements:
  • Must possess a valid Driver’s License
  • High School Diploma (or equivalent) a must
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ills in English.
  • Exceptional customer service is mandatory.
Job Specific Skills:
  • Minimum 2 years of experience driving a commercial truck
  • Must be able to follow maps or directions to meet destination in a safe and efficient manner.
  • Able to understand and complete basic math

Work Hours:
  • Morning or afternoon shift available
  • May include working on the weekends or during Holidays.

Physical / Mental Requirements:
  • Assigned duties are accomplished primarily driving the truck and an industrial setting.
  • Able to operate truck lift gate and back-up trucks correctly and safely into tight places
  • Able to push/pull cars loaded with linen weighing approximately up to 700 pounds
  • May be at an industrial setting with heat/cold and distracting noise levels
Job Location:
865 Kinoole Street, Hilo HI 96720

Wage Information:
  • The wage is no less than $16.00 per hour. Overtime pay starts at $24.00 per hour.
  • A higher rate than $16.00 may be offered, the overtime rate will be calculated 1.5X the offered hourly rate.
  • Our Company's pay period starts on a Sunday and ends on a Saturday. A single work week will be used to compute the wages due.
  • Our payroll period is weekly, and workers are paid on the following Thursday after the end of the pay period.
  • Rate increases and/or bonuses may be offered at the Company's discretion, based on individual factors such as performance, skill, and tenure.
  • The Company will make deductions from the worker's paycheck as required by law. Workers may elect to participate in our benefits plans such as medical, drug, vision, dental, FSA and other voluntary insurance plans, in which a share in premium may be deducted.
  • Any deductions will be preauthorized in writing.

Work Environment:
  • The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
  • The working environment is typical of an industrial facility including noise and vibration. An employee is occasionally exposed to moving mechanical parts, fumes or airborne particles, and vibration. Personal Protective Equipment will be required for certain tasks.

Safety:
  • All employees are responsible for their personal safety and safety of others. Therefore, all employees must:
  • Participate fully in company health and safety programs and comply with all company OSHA policies and procedures.
  • Follow all lawful employer safety and health rules.
  • Wear and / or use Personal Protective Equipment, when and how instructed.
  • Report hazardous conditions to management.
  • Report any job-related injury or illness to management and seek treatment promptly.
  • Other duties as requested.
